A boss, in politics, is a person who wields disproportionate power and influence over a political region or constituency. Political bosses are often associated with corruption and organized crime and are generally regarded as subversive to the democratic process. Bosses may dictate voting patterns, control appointments, and wield considerable influence in other political processes.
